July 2007
Two Bear Stearns hedge funds collapse, signaling subprime mortgage crisis
July 2007
Sowood Capital Management of Boston loses half its assets and winds down funds
September 2008
Financial crisis explodes and stocks plunge everywhere
June 2009
Boston’s James Pallotta winds down Raptor hedge fund after poor performance
November 2010
FBI launches nationwide insider-trading inquiry of hedge funds with raids at Level Global Investors, Diamondback Capital Management, and Boston’s Loch Capital Management
October 2011
Raj Rajaratnam, former head of $7 billion hedge fund Galleon Group, sentenced to 11 years in prison for insider trading
November 2012
Red Sox owner John Henry closes his commodities hedge fund after lackluster performance
December 2012
Hedge fund giant SAC Capital comes under scrutiny after former manager Mathew Martoma’s arrest on insider trading charges
